New officers should be installed with an appropriate ceremony to impress upon them the seriousness of their undertaking. The importance of attendance at the ceremony should be stressed. It is entirely appropriate that school officials, faculty, parents, and current local chapter members be present at the induction of students into an honor society of this caliber. Not all induction ceremonies must be elaborate or formal, but all should respect the honor of being selected for membership. Each chapter is required to have at least one induction a year some chapters elect to have more. It encourages continued involvement of all members and recognizes the special camaraderie of Sigma Tau Delta members everywhere. The induction ceremony is a very special event and should be viewed as a dignified celebration of the academic achievement of new members. Membership certificates and pins are generally mailed to the Lead Advisor within one week of receipt of payment in the Central Office. Candidates are not official members until their names have been entered in Write Away, Sigma Tau Delta's online chapter management system, and their one-time international induction fees have been received by and recorded in the Central Office. Formal induction ceremonies emphasize the accomplishment of becoming a member of Sigma Tau Delta.
